(Arlington, VA)  —  The 3rd U.S. Infantry has again honored America’s fallen heroes by placing American flags at every gravestone at Arlington National Cemetery and the U.S. Soldier’s and Airmen’s Home National Cemetery.  The tradition known as flags-in has taken place every Memorial Day weekend since The Old Guard was designated as the Army’s official ceremonial unit in 1948. Every available soldier in the 3rd Infantry participates, placing small American flags one foot in front and centered before every gravestone. Old Guard soldiers will remain in the cemetery through the weekend, ensuring that a flag remains at each site. The flags will be removed June 1st.
